Cmdr. John M. Connally

EXECUTIVE OFFICER / CHIEF OF STAFF, NAVAL COMPUTER AND TELECOMMUNICATIONS AREA MASTER STATION ATLANTIC (NCTAMS LANT)

Cmdr. John M. Connally is currently assigned as the Executive Officer of NCTAMS LANT Norfolk, Va.  A native of Oklahoma, he enlisted in the Navy in 1989 and graduated from RTC San Diego in 1990. He was commissioned via the Limited Duty Officer Program in 2005 and in 2011 lateral transferred to the Information Professional (IP) community. He earned a Master of Science in Cyber Security Digital Forensics and Investigations from the University of Maryland in 2014 and a Master of Defense Studies from the Royal Military College of Canada in 2020.
 
As a Radioman, his assignments included USS Defender (MCM 2), Fleet Air Reconnaissance Squadron 3, Joint Communications Support Element, and Explosive Ordnance Disposal Mobile Unit 8.  He conducted multiple deployments to include the North Atlantic, Bosnia and Operation Enduring Freedom I. He promoted to the rank of Chief Petty Officer in 2001. His warfare qualifications include the Enlisted Surface Warfare Specialist, Naval Aircrewman, and Naval Parachutist. 
 
As an Information Warfare Officer, Cmdr. Connally has completed operational tours as the Communications Officer aboard USS Tarawa (LHA 1); Officer-in-Charge (OIC) with Naval Special Warfare Development Group; Operational Planner with Joint Special Operations Command; and as the Control, Communications, Computers, Combat Systems and Intelligence (C5I) Officer on board USS Mount Whitney (LCC 20).
 
He has conducted multiple deployments afloat and ashore to include Afghanistan, Iraq, SE Asia and across the continent of Africa. He has served as an OIC and as Director of Communications of Special Operations Task Forces, leading Joint, Inter-Agency C4ISR professionals.
 
Staff assignments include United States Africa Command, as the Satellite / Spectrum Branch Chief; Navy Personnel Command as the IP Junior Officer Detailer; Information Warfare Training Command San Diego as the Executive Officer; and as an International Exchange Student to the Canadian Forces Staff College Command.
 
His warfare qualifications include Surface Warfare Officer and Information Warfare Officer.
 
Cmdr. Connally is the recipient of various personal and campaign awards including the Meritorious Service Medal (two awards), Bronze Star Medal, Defense Meritorious Service Medal (three awards), Joint Service Commendation Medal (four awards), Navy Commendation Medal (two awards), Joint Achievement Medal (two awards), Navy Achievement Medal (three awards) and Combat Action Award.
